LINUX.ORG.RU

История изменений

Исправление AntonI, (текущая версия) :

ограничение области видимости, это один из основных столпов ООП

Нет конечно. Более того, в плюсах эти механизмы ломаются на раз. Ограничение области видимости это всего лишь рекомендация юзеру не лазить грязными руками куда не надо. В питоне можно ввести аналогичные соглашения если хочется.

Понятие объекта и экземпляра класса в Питоне очень мутно.

Совершенно прозрачно.

А передача по ссылке или по значению, это же жуть в питоне!

В питоне все всегда передаётся по ссылке.

Никто не говорит что питон идеальный яп, да там много косяков. Но для обучения он хорош, и в своей нише (маленькие приложения, быстрое прототипирование и тд) он вне конкуренции.

Аннотирование функций - там кстати офигенный встроенный хелп, именно просмотр аннотаций он и предоставляет:-)

Исходная версия AntonI, :

ограничение области видимости, это один из основных столпов ООП

Нет конечно. Более того, в плюсах эти механизмы ломаются на паз. Ограничение области видимости это всего лишь рекомендация юзеру не лазить грязными руками куда не надо. В питоне можно ввести аналогичные соглашения если хочется.

Понятие объекта и экземпляра класса в Питоне очень мутно.

Совершенно прозрачно.

А передача по ссылке или по значению, это же жуть в питоне!

В питоне все всегда передаётся по ссылке.

Никто не говорит что питон идеальный яп, да там много косяков. Но для обучения он хорош, и в своей нише (маленькие приложения, быстрое прототипирование и тд) он вне конкуренции.

Аннотирование функций - там оюкстати офигенный встроенный хелп, именно просмотр аннотаций он и предоставляет:-)